**Handover: FareSplit Pricing Experiment**

Welcome aboard. This covers the ticket-pricing experiment Tomas ran on the Quillbridge events platform. Variant B applies dynamic discounts 48 hours before showtime; variant A is control. Metrics land in the FareSplit dashboard nightly. The experiment config lives in the pricing-flags repo; don't edit it mid-week or the analysis window breaks. Results review is every Thursday with the Larkmoor growth team. Access to the experiment admin panel requires the recovery passphrase shown here.

unlock words, tagaf-hahif: ralwyn-lammir-rusax-sormir

# Env file — Cartwheel dispatch, driver-assignment heuristic
# Scope: staging only. Do not promote to prod.
# The heuristic weights (proximity, shift balance, refusal rate) are tuned
# for the Velmont pilot region and will misbehave elsewhere.
# Review notes: heuristic service runs unprivileged; it reads weights
# read-only from the tuning store and writes nothing back.
# Only one sensitive value exists in this file: the tuning-store access
# credential, consumed at boot and never logged.
# That credential is set on the following line.

secret setting of faduf-bahop: LEDGER_TOKEN8=c3b363be

Subject: Rotating the Gaugewright sidecar key this Thursday

Hey folks — quick heads-up before the sync. We're rotating the credential that the Gaugewright metrics-aggregation sidecar uses to push rollups to Tallyvane. The old key stops working Thursday at noon, so update your local compose files before then or your dashboards will go blank and you'll ping me anyway. Staging is already done. The new key for the sidecar is below.

gateway credential: kto23_LX9A4ys6i4nzHtpOLNLodKK

Turnstile counters at Harwick Arena must be verified before gates open. Run the Gatesum reconciliation script against all 42 units, confirm zero drift between the Tallyline backend and the physical click registers, and reset any unit showing stale heartbeats. Do not skip units in the east concourse; they lag. Sign off in the Fennick release sheet. The verification build token follows.

build token for kagaf-hahof: htk14_9d3d4d26d7d8de